Abstract :
Changes in light intensity cause major difficulties in the plant recognition. In order to solve this problem, we started the development of a plant recognition method, with high efficiency in variable lighting conditions. This will be implemented to an autonomous mobile robot for weed control. The method consists in determining of dependency relations between the leaves color and the light intensity.
